1. Read all instructions in this manual before using the weight rack. Use the weight rack only as described in this manual.
2. It is the responsibility of the owner to ensure that all users of the weight rack are adequate­ly informed of all precautions.
3. The weight rack is intended for home use only. Do not use the weight rack in any com­mercial, rental, or institutional setting.
4. Use the weight rack only on a level surface. Cover the floor beneath the weight rack to protect the floor.
5. Make sure all parts are properly tightened each time the weight rack is used. Replace any worn parts immediately.
6. Keep children under 12 and pets away from the weight rack at all times.
7. The weight rack is designed to support a maxi-
mum of 310 pounds of weights (not included).
8. Always place the heaviest weight plates on
the lower storage tube.

Attach the Stabilizer (1) to the Base (2) with two M10 x 120mm Bolts (11), two M10 Washers (9), and two M10 Nylon Locknuts (8). Make sure the
serial number decal is in the position shown.
2. Press two Rectangle Inner Caps (6) into the top of the Frame (3). Press two Angled Inner Caps (7) into the bottom of the Frame. Slide four Bumper Rings (4) onto the tubes on the Frame. Press four Round Inner Caps (5) into the tubes.
Attach the Frame (3) to the Base (2) with two M10 x 168mm Bolts (10), four M10 Washers (9), and two M10 Nylon Locknuts (8).
3. Make sure that all parts are properly tightened
before you use the weight rack.

This section explains how to adjust the weight rack. Make sure all parts are properly tightened each time the weight rack is used. Replace any worn parts immediately. The weight rack can be cleaned with a damp cloth and a mild, non-abrasive detergent. Do not use solvents.
6
STORING WEIGHTS
Your weights can be stored on the storage tubes while they are not being used. The lower storage bar can hold up to four 45-pound weight plates. The upper storage bar can hold a combination of weight plates totaling 130 pounds.
Storage
Tubes
ADJUSTMENTS
WARNING:Always store an equal
amount of weight on each side of the weight rack. Place the heaviest weights on the lower storage tube. Do not place more than 310 pounds on the weight rack.
